HSLS:09 Items Chosen to Comprise Motivational Scales
| Motivation Scale | |
|---|---|
| Prompt Item | Scale of Measurement |
| Identity | |
| How much do you agree or disagree with the following statements? | Likert, 1-4 |
| 1. You see yourself as a math person | Strongly Agree |
| 2. Others see you as a math person | Agree |
| Disagree | |
| Strongly Disagree | |
| Interest | |
| How much do you agree or disagree with the following statements about your fall 2009 math course? | Likert 1-4 |
| Strongly Agree | |
| 1. You are enjoying this class very much | Agree |
| 2. You think this class is a waste of your time (R) | Disagree |
| 3. You think this class is boring (R) | Strongly Disagree |
| Utility | |
| How much do you agree or disagree with the following statements about the usefulness of your Fall 2009 math course? What students learn in this course … | Likert 1-4 |
| Strongly Agree | |
| 1. is useful for everyday life. | Agree |
| 2. will be useful for college. | Disagree |
| 3. will be useful for a future career. | Strongly Disagree |
| Self-Efficacy | |
| How much do you agree or disagree with the following statements about your fall 2009 math course? | Likert 1-4 |
| Strongly Agree | |
| 1. You are confident that you can do an excellent job on tests in this course | Agree |
| 2. You are certain that you can understand the most difficult material presented in the text- | Disagree |
| book used in this course | Strongly Disagree |
| 3. You are certain that you can master the skills being taught in this course | |
| 4. You are confident that you can do an excellent job on assignments in this course | |
| Effort | |
| How often do you … | Likert 1-4 |
| 1. go to class without your homework done? (R) | Never |
| 2. go to class without pencil or paper? (R) | Rarely |
| 3. go to class without books? (R) | Sometimes |
| 4. go to class late? (R) | Often |
| During a typical weekday during the school year how many hours do you spend working on math homework and studying for math class? | Multiple Choice: |
| < 1 hour | |
| 1 to 2 hours | |
| 2 to 3 hours | |
| 3 to 4 hours | |
| 4 to 5 hours | |
| 5 or more hours | |
